Root-associated microorganisms, such as plant growth-promoting rhizobacteria (PGPR) belonging to the Bacillus genus, play a crucial role in enhancing crop yield and health. In this study, a Bacillus strain was isolated from the rhizosphere soil of maize and identified as Bacillus velezensis D103. The objective of this research was to evaluate the potential of D103 as a PGPR. Laboratory tests revealed that D103 possessed the ability to fix nitrogen, dissolve inorganic phosphorus, dissolve potassium, synthesize indole acetic acid (IAA), ammonia, siderophores, amylase, protease, cellulase, beta-1,3-glucanase, and ACC deaminase, as well as demonstrating swimming and swarming motility, biofilm formation, and an antagonistic effect against pathogenic fungi. Genome mining approaches identified genes associated with growth promotion and biocontrol activities in D103. In a hydroponics experiment, treatment of maize with D103 suspension at a cell density of 103 CFU mL-1 resulted in the most pronounced growth stimulation of maize, with shoot length and total root length increasing by 43% and 148%, respectively. Collectively, this supports the potential use of D103 as a PGPR with positive efficacy in promoting maize crop growth.
